Output 67e15512b93dcb9ae918dce7d060b5b10517efe6a70386c2494fe497f2827b95:18

value
683000
script pubkey
OP_0 OP_PUSHBYTES_20 0b97d1b1929f89d2952218affed5e18560bdddee
address
bc1qpwtarvvjn7ya99fzrzhla40ps4stmh0wlwjkeu
transaction
67e15512b93dcb9ae918dce7d060b5b10517efe6a70386c2494fe497f2827b95
confirmations
122211
spent
true